Advantages and disadvantages of Metal Roof



Metal roofing provides a compelling combination of durability and power effectiveness, making it a preferred selection among house owners. One considerable advantage is its lengthy life-span; steel roofings can last 50 years or more with appropriate maintenance.

They're additionally immune to extreme weather, consisting of heavy snow, rainfall, and wind. In addition, steel shows sunshine, which helps reduce cooling down costs in hot climates.

Nevertheless, there are some drawbacks to consider. Metal roofing can be extra pricey in advance compared to traditional products, which might strain your spending plan.

Installment can additionally be complicated, calling for skilled experts to ensure an appropriate fit and seal. If you stay in a noisy location, you could locate that during heavy rain or hail, the audio can be intensified, potentially troubling your tranquility.

Another indicate consider is the visual selection. While steel roofings come in numerous styles and shades, they mightn't suit every architectural layout.

Benefits and drawbacks of Asphalt Shingles



Asphalt shingles are among one of the most prominent roof covering materials for home owners as a result of their price and ease of setup. They can be found in a selection of shades and designs, enabling you to match your home's aesthetic.

Nonetheless, there are some drawbacks to take into consideration. Asphalt shingles typically have a much shorter lifespan, balancing around 15 to thirty years, depending upon the quality.

They're likewise prone to harm from high winds and hail storm, which can result in costly repair work. Additionally, asphalt roof shingles aren't one of the most eco-friendly alternative, as they're petroleum-based and can add to garbage dump waste at the end of their life.
